Malabar Snakehead

  • Care Level: Moderate
  • Minimum Tank Size: 400 litres (88 gallons)
  • Temperament: Aggressive
  • pH Range: 6 – 8
  • Temperature Range: 22–28°C (72–82°F)
  • Water Flow: Moderate

Description:

The Malabar Snakehead, Channa diplogramma, is one of the most enigmatic and rare members of the snakehead family, Channidae. Native to Peninsular India, this species has long puzzled scientists due to its strong resemblance to the Giant Snakehead Channa micropeltes) of Southeast Asia.

Recent studies involving both morphological and molecular analysis have confirmed its distinct identity and revealed fascinating insights into its evolutionary lineage. Juveniles of this species are social and often hunt in groups, a behaviour that is relatively rare in snakeheads.

Behaviour and Aquarium Requirements:

Like all snakeheads, the Malabar Snakehead has an accessory respiratory organ, enabling it to breathe atmospheric air and survive in low-oxygen waters. This also means they can survive out of water for extended periods, so a strong, tightly-fitting lid is crucial to prevent escape.

Due to their aggressive and predatory nature, Malabar Snakeheads are best kept in species-only aquariums or with similarly sized, robust fish such as large catfish, gars, or plecos. Tank mates must be chosen with care and must not be small enough to be viewed as prey.

Feeding:

In the wild, Channa diplogramma feeds on fish, frogs, insects, and crustaceans. In captivity, they should be provided with a constant supply of live prey. Over time, many specimens will accept frozen food, earthworms, insects, frogs, and even prepared dry foods. Variety is essential to maintain health and colouration.
